10 U.S.C. § 1706
(a) Goal.— It shall be the goal of the Department of Defense and each of the military departments to ensure that, for each major defense acquisition program and each major automated information system program, each of the following positions is performed by a properly qualified member of the armed forces or full-time employee of the Department of Defense:

Section 2445a of this title, referred to in subsec. (c)(2), was repealed by Pub. L. 114–328, div. A, title VIII, § 846(1), , 130 Stat. 2292, effective .
A prior section 1706, added Pub. L. 101–510, div. A, title XII, § 1202(a), , 104 Stat. 1639, which related to acquisition career program boards, was repealed by Pub. L. 108–136, div. A, title VIII, § 831(a), , 117 Stat. 1549.
Provisions similar to this section were contained in section 820 of Pub. L. 109–364, which was set out as a note under section 1701 of this title prior to repeal by Pub. L. 112–239, div. A, title VIII, § 824(b), , 126 Stat. 1833.
